首页主机资讯java中重载的作用有哪些

java中重载的作用有哪些

时间2023-12-09 18:31:03发布访客分类主机资讯浏览261
导读:Java中重载的作用有以下几点: 提高代码的复用性:通过重载可以定义多个具有相同名字但参数列表不同的方法,使得相似的功能可以通过调用不同的方法来实现,提高代码的复用性。 增加代码的可读性:通过使用重载,可以根据方法名来推测方法的功能...

Java中重载的作用有以下几点:

  1. 提高代码的复用性:通过重载可以定义多个具有相同名字但参数列表不同的方法,使得相似的功能可以通过调用不同的方法来实现,提高代码的复用性。

  2. 增加代码的可读性:通过使用重载,可以根据方法名来推测方法的功能,使得代码更加易读易懂。

  3. 减少命名冲突:当需要定义多个功能相似但参数类型不同的方法时,使用重载可以避免命名冲突,不需要为每个方法取不同的名字。

  4. 优化程序设计:通过重载可以对方法的参数进行范围限制,例如可以定义一个接收整数参数的方法和一个接收浮点数参数的方法,分别处理不同类型的参数。

  5. 支持多态:重载是实现多态的一种方式,当调用一个重载的方法时,Java会根据传入的参数选择合适的方法进行调用。这样可以根据不同的参数选择不同的方法实现,实现多态性。

声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!


若转载请注明出处: java中重载的作用有哪些
本文地址: https://pptw.com/jishu/575054.html
java中标识符的定义和作用是什么 python中怎么用circle函数画多边形

游客 回复需填写必要信息